Definition of General Education Courses and Technical Courses Sample Clauses

Definition of General Education Courses and Technical Courses. The Associate in Applied Science Early Childhood Education degree program in the North Carolina Community College System requires a total of sixty-four to seventy-six semester hours credit for graduation (see Appendix C), sixty of which are transferable to any UNC institution (see Appendix A). The overall total is comprised of both lower-division general education and early childhood education courses. This curriculum reflects the distribution of discipline areas commonly included in institution-wide, lower-division general education requirements for the baccalaureate degree. The Associate in Applied Science Early Childhood Education degree program includes general education requirements that represent the fundamental foundation for success, with studies in the areas of English composition, communications, humanities and fine arts, natural sciences and mathematics, and social and behavioral sciences. Within these discipline areas, community colleges must include opportunities for the achievement of competence in reading, writing, oral communication, fundamental mathematical skills, and basic computer use. Additionally, the Associate in Applied Science in Early Childhood Education degree program includes technical courses in the field of early childhood education, which include study in the areas of child development for both typical and atypical development, child guidance, health, safety and nutrition, creative activities, language and literacy, working with children and diverse families, and field experiences/practicums. Students must meet the receiving university's foreign language and/or health and physical education requirements, if applicable, prior to or after transfer to the four-year institution. The Associate in Applied Science Early Childhood Education degree program is structured to include three components: • Universal General Education Transfer Component comprises a minimum of 15 semester hours of credit, including at least one course from each of the following areas: humanities/fine arts, social/behavioral sciences, and natural sciences/mathematics. AAS Degree programs must contain a minimum of 6 semester hours of communications. Diploma programs must contain a minimum of 6 semester hours of general education; 3 semester hours must be in communications.
